Description

Fjällräven's Bergtagen Eco-Shell pants for women are designed for demanding alpine expeditions and extreme weather conditions. Waterproof, breathable, and windproof, they offer reliable protection thanks to their 3-layer Eco-Shell membrane made from recycled polyester. Their robust, articulated design ensures optimal freedom of movement, while full-length side zippers facilitate ventilation and make them easy to pull on over boots or mid-layers.


Advantages • 3-layer Eco-Shell membrane offering waterproof and breathable protection.
• Ergonomic fit and stretch fabric for total mobility.
• Full-length side zippers for quick ventilation.
• Abrasion-resistant reinforcements on the lower legs.
• Ideal for mountaineering, ski touring, and demanding treks.

Features


• Material: 3-layer Eco-Shell (100% recycled polyester, PFC-free water-repellent finish).

• Technical features: waterproof, breathable, windproof, water-repellent.

• Membrane type: 3L Eco-Shell (waterproof and durable membrane).

• Weight: approx. 520 g.

• Adjustments: adjustable waist, full-length side zippers, integrated gaiters.

• Activity: mountaineering, ski touring, trekking, expeditions.
